Book Description

1880090805 978-1880090800 September 1, 1999 1
Minnesota’s Twin Cities business community is known worldwide for the citizenship and integrity of its corporations and corporate leaders. How did they do it? Bockelman provides the thought-provoking answers and guidelines.

About the Author

Wilfred Bockelman has forged a lifetime career in theology and journalism. He recieved a Masters of Journalism from Columbia University's Graduate School of Journalism. In addition to several books and numerous magazine articles on religious subjects he has also developed an interest in business and ethics. He was the founder and for 14 years the editor of a newsletter, The Eyes of the Needle: The Responsible Use of Wealth, Power and Position. He is curretnly working on a book that combines his interests, On the 8th Day God Created Money. --This text refers to the Paperback edition.
